Output 515bc304cffe2433a373547bf6038bf26e0cf49faf0bced753d70524615186f9:1

value
3583003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fc20a666974fe6d6169bf5bc71189d3c9605f68 OP_EQUALVERIFY OP_CHECKSIG
address
1E785cRYuHRLnhpbzF2KSfbT9JLzEyMroF
transaction
515bc304cffe2433a373547bf6038bf26e0cf49faf0bced753d70524615186f9
spent
true